2
1
Эх сурвалжийг харах

package/sconeserver: add sqlite optional dependency

sqlite is an optional dependency which is enabled by default since
https://github.com/sconemad/sconeserver/commit/4120395991c2c63abef58426beee4ecf5879c204

Signed-off-by: Fabrice Fontaine <fontaine.fabrice@gmail.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
(cherry picked from commit 117b15866a1d1b87adc87b95768f2a0a62b13905)
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
Fabrice Fontaine 3 жил өмнө
parent
commit
6d5d5c0693

+ 6 - 0
package/sconeserver/Config.in

@@ -76,6 +76,12 @@ config BR2_PACKAGE_SCONESERVER_RSS
 	help
 	  RSS module for Sconeserver
 
+config BR2_PACKAGE_SCONESERVER_SQLITE
+	bool "sqlite"
+	select BR2_PACKAGE_SQLITE
+	help
+	  SQLite module for Sconeserver
+
 config BR2_PACKAGE_SCONESERVER_TESTBUILDER
 	bool "testbuilder"
 	help

+ 7 - 0
package/sconeserver/sconeserver.mk

@@ -91,6 +91,13 @@ else
 SCONESERVER_CONF_OPTS += --without-rss
 endif
 
+ifeq ($(BR2_PACKAGE_SCONESERVER_SQLITE),y)
+SCONESERVER_DEPENDENCIES += sqlite
+SCONESERVER_CONF_OPTS += --with-sqlite
+else
+SCONESERVER_CONF_OPTS += --without-sqlite
+endif
+
 ifeq ($(BR2_PACKAGE_SCONESERVER_TESTBUILDER),y)
 SCONESERVER_CONF_OPTS += --with-testbuilder
 else